Coffs Coast Legacy is celebrating funding success which will allow this outstanding community organisation to proceed with a vital project.
The Coffs Harbour Legacy Welfare Fund has secured a $70,000 grant from the NSW Government’s Community Building Partnership Program which will be used to purchase a new vehicle for the Coffs Coast Legacy Opportunity Shop in Scarba Street.
Member for Coffs Harbour Gurmesh Singh said the Op Shop is an important part of our local community, raising funds for programs which support veterans and their families, along with providing items for those in need.
“The Op Shop requires a new vehicle to collect donations and deliver items to Legacy families,” Mr Singh said.
“This funding will enable Legacy to replace its existing and ageing vehicle with a new one.
“Coffs Coast Legacy is dedicated to caring for the families of veterans who have given their lives or health in the service of our country. It’s a remarkable local organisation deserving of support.”
Mr Singh said the Coffs Coast had secured more than $440,000 in funding for local projects through the 2025 Community Building Partnership Program.
